The performance of PVC products is heavily influenced by the additives used in their formulation. Among these, heat stabilizers play a critical role in protecting the polymer during high-temperature processing and ensuring its longevity in various applications. Calcium Zinc Stabilizers have gained significant traction in the PVC industry due to their impressive array of features, offering a balance of performance, safety, and environmental compatibility. What Makes Calcium Zinc Stabilizers Stand Out?

Calcium Zinc Stabilizers are a sophisticated blend of calcium and zinc compounds, often augmented with organic co-stabilizers and lubricants. This synergistic combination provides PVC with a robust defense against thermal degradation while enhancing its overall physical properties. Let's break down their most important characteristics:

  • Exceptional Heat Stability: This is perhaps the most crucial feature. Calcium Zinc Stabilizers effectively scavenge HCl released during PVC processing, thereby preventing dehydrochlorination. This ensures that the PVC material remains stable at processing temperatures, preventing discoloration, charring, and degradation. This property is fundamental for applications requiring prolonged exposure to heat.
  • High Transparency and Whiteness: A significant advantage over older stabilizer systems is the ability of Calcium Zinc Stabilizers to maintain and even enhance the clarity and whiteness of PVC. This is invaluable for products like transparent hoses, films, window profiles, and decorative panels where aesthetic appeal is a primary concern.
  • Good Weatherability and UV Resistance: Many Calcium Zinc formulations also offer excellent resistance to UV radiation and weathering. This protection prevents degradation, fading, and embrittlement when PVC products are used in outdoor environments, such as in construction materials or automotive components.
  • Improved Lubrication and Dispersion: The integrated lubricants within Calcium Zinc Stabilizer packages contribute to smoother processing, better melt flow, and improved dispersion of pigments and fillers. This leads to reduced energy consumption, faster production cycles, and superior surface finish on the final products.
  • Environmental Safety and Non-Toxicity: A hallmark of Calcium Zinc Stabilizers is their formulation without heavy metals. They are recognized as environmentally friendly and non-toxic alternatives, complying with global health and safety standards, making them suitable for a wide range of applications including those requiring food contact or medical approvals.
